Rethinking Drug Policy: A Historical Perspective
This chapter examines the historical context and societal perceptions surrounding drug use, contrasting the harms of legal substances like alcohol with those of criminalized drugs such as psychedelics. It discusses the impact of legislative decisions on drug research, treatment, and societal norms, addressing ongoing debates about legalization and decriminalization. The chapter advocates for a rational approach to drug policy that prioritizes public health over criminalization, citing evidence from successful reform efforts.
